The European Commission has banned the export of sheep and goats from Romania due to a recent outbreak of Peste des Petits Ruminants (PPR). This decision, effective until December 31, 2026, follows a confirmed case in Mureș County. Romania had anticipated exports worth 300 million euros this year, having previously resumed shipments to Arab countries. The Commission emphasized the need for strict health measures to protect the EU's animal health status. To lift the ban, Romania may need to implement vaccination programs, with plans to vaccinate 1.2 million animals. Financial compensation mechanisms for affected farmers are also being considered.
